Abstract: Building regulations in Portugal are fragmented across various legal instruments (codes, laws, decree‐laws, municipal regulations, etc.), hindering consultation and understanding for both professionals and researchers. This paper proposes a hierarchical organization methodology, grouping the main legal statutes and technical standards into major thematic clusters to facilitate research and practical application. Based on a comprehensive review, the content was structured into progressive levels (ranging from general provisions to technical specifications), demonstrating the utility of this model for databases or information systems. Finally, this organization was applied to a hypothetical case study to validate its future use. This structure is expected to contribute to the development of a database for an Automated Code Checking system. [ABSTRACT FROM AUTHOR]
